Empowering Entrepreneurs Disability-Inclusive Incubator Spurs Business Growth Across China

From sign language information products developed by hearing-impaired designers to sports rehabilitation launched by entrepreneurs with physical impairments, a business incubation base in southwest China's Chongqing Municipality showcases the remarkable abilities of individuals with disabilities. This initiative challenges misconceptions by highlighting the strengths and innovation within the disabled community.

Wang Lin, a renowned florist with a physical impairment, exemplifies the success fostered by the base. Driven by a desire to prove her capabilities, Wang established a flourishing flower business at the incubation base in 2022. As a national-level technical expert and cultural heritage inheritor, she not only runs her business but also serves as a mentor and advocate for fellow disabled entrepreneurs.

Guided by the Chongqing City Disabled Persons' Federation, the base accommodates 41 enterprises, many of which are led by individuals with disabilities. These ventures extend beyond traditional boundaries, with entrepreneurs diversifying into areas like coffee shops and car washes, creating employment opportunities for disabled individuals.

Entrepreneurs like Zhang Chao, who experienced paralysis due to a cerebral hemorrhage, exemplify the base's impact. Through her rehabilitation centers established across China, Zhang provides vital services to over 800 people with disabilities, showcasing the transformative power of entrepreneurship.

The base's commitment extends beyond business incubation, offering training, exhibitions, and employment assistance. With a total output value exceeding 104.16 million yuan, this initiative underscores the economic and societal contributions of disabled individuals, fostering inclusivity and empowerment.
